This is important to remove plaque and food particles from your teeth that could lead to dental problems.&nbsp;Fluoride toothpaste is recommended for brushing your teeth for two minutes.&nbsp;Make sure you brush all surfaces, including the chewing and front surfaces.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Good oral hygiene includes flossing daily&nbsp;It removes food particles and plaque from between your teeth, which brushing alone cannot reach.&nbsp;Make sure you floss properly and at least once per day.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Use mouthwash Mouthwash helps kill bacteria and freshen breath.&nbsp;The American Dental Association (ADA) has approved mouthwashes that contain fluoride.&nbsp;Remember that mouthwash is not meant to replace brushing and flossing.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Sugary and acidic drinks and foods should be limited. Tooth enamel can be eroded and cavities may result.&nbsp;Limit sugary and acidic foods, drinks, and beverages, like soda, candy, and citrus fruits.&nbsp;Be sure to brush your teeth after you have had these foods and drinks.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Water is vital for healthy teeth. Drinking plenty of water is important.&nbsp;Water can wash away bacteria and food particles that could cause gum disease and tooth decay.&nbsp;Water can also be used to prevent dry mouth which can cause bad breath and other dental problems.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Sugar-free gum is a good choice. Sugar-free gum can stimulate saliva production. This can wash away food particles and neutralize acids in your mouth.&nbsp;Gum that contains xylitol has been proven to prevent cavities.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>For good oral health, regular dental visits are important.&nbsp;Dental problems can be detected early and treated before they become more severe.&nbsp;Make sure you schedule dental cleanings and checkups at least once every six months.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Stop smoking.
